Los Angeles Angels' Shohei Ohtani wants to remain 2-way player in 2021

LOS ANGELES -- Shohei Ohtani wants to remain a two-way player for the Los Angeles Angels, even though he didn't come close during the shortened season to matching his performance from 2018.

Ohtani went 1 for 4 with a strikeout -- and grounded out to first for the final out -- in a 5-0 loss to the Dodgers on Sunday that ended the Angels' season.

The Japanese star batted .190 during the 60-game season. Pitching-wise, he suffered a forearm strain that limited him to parts of three innings over two games before he had to shut it down on the mound.
